There’s a common misconception when it comes to the Great Pacific Garbage Patch: that it’s an actual island. This misconception probably comes from the fact that it is sometimes called ‘plastic island’. It is not an island, rather it is a huge patch of ocean that contains a high ...

Web16 Jul 2024 · A major plastic accumulation zone is the Great Pacific Garbage Patch (GPGP), the world’s largest zone of accumulated plastic among five (refer to the figure below). Located in the North Pacific Ocean, between Hawaii and California, the GPGP covers an area of approximately 1.6 million km 2 (The Ocean Cleanup, n.d.). The water currents here happen to make lots of plastic rubbish drift together, and I mean lots – an area almost the size of Queensland. Until now, it's been too difficult, too big, and too expensive to do much about it.
